Tamaqua Mayor Nathan Gerace Supports Dan Meuser For Congress

Pottsville- Dan Meuser for Congress is pleased to announce the endorsement from Tamaqua Mayor Nathan Gerace. 

In early 2018, Gerace was sworn in as Mayor of Tamaqua at age nineteen, the youngest ever to hold the position, with the stated goals of encouraging greater hometown pride, getting youth more actively involved in the community and increasing community interaction with the police department.

"I am regularly noted for 'youthful energy' in news reports, but if you want to see energy, look at Dan Meuser. He has been all over the 9th Congressional District meeting with voters for over a year, in Schuylkill County and, specifically, Tamaqua many times over. His work ethic is tireless and that is something we should want to see in our next congressman, " said Gerace, "I am also very encouraged by his business background, commitment to public private partnerships and opportunity zones that will help the prosperity of places like Tamaqua, as well as by his dedication to battling the opioid epidemic plaguing our region and his support of law enforcement." 

"I thank Mayor Gerace for his endorsement and I look forward to working with him and the patriotic, hard-working community of Tamaqua, on the priorities that matter to Mayor Gerace and the residents to create an environment that revives the economy of the region," said Meuser.

Dan Meuser is a Candidate for US Congress. Dan has served both as a private sector businessman responsible for helping create thousands of jobs and as Secretary of the Department of Revenue for the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ania. Dan has been endorsed by countless elected officials.
